What is an Auto Locksmith?
An Auto Locksmith UK locksmith is a professional who concentrates on vehicle locks and security systems. Unlike conventional locksmiths who may deal with residential and commercial locks, auto locksmiths have specialized training to handle the different complexities associated with Automotive Locksmith locking systems. Their services include lockouts, key replacement, reprogramming transponder secrets, and ignition repairs.

Auto locksmiths make use of a variety of tools and methods to perform their work efficiently. Some of the typical tools in an auto locksmith's toolbox include:
Lock Picks: Used for manual unlocking in traditional locking systems.Slim Jim: A tool that allows locksmith professionals to unlock cars without a key by controling the internal mechanism.Secret Cutting Machines: These devices create duplicates of secrets or cut brand-new ones based on a code.Secret Programmers: Devices used to program transponder keys and essential fobs properly.Diagnostic Tools: Equipment that assists repair electronic lock systems typically discovered in modern lorries.Table 3: Essential Tools Used by Auto LocksmithsToolFunctionLock PicksUtilized for manual unlocking of standard locks.Slim JimOpens doors without harming the lorry.Secret Cutting MachinesCuts keys based on original crucial templates.Secret ProgrammersPrograms transponder keys and fobs for electronic cars.Diagnostic ToolsAnalyzes and troubleshoots electronic locking systems.Selecting the Right Auto Locksmith
